C-Suite Travel

C-Suite TravelStats Gate

Top 5 Luxurious Hotels In Italy

Italy is one of those countries that every person wishes to visit once in a lifetime. The Roman Empire, Italy's capital, offers regal residences and historical monuments. Whereas places like Positano and Sicily come with their spectacular scenery and sun-kissed beaches. Venice and Florence depict striking Renaissance architecture that one...
C-Suite Travel

Top 5 Places To Visit In Canada

The second-largest country worldwide is Canada. This place has infinite, beautiful landscapes and unique locations to explore. In Western Canada, the best attractions to dominate are the Rocky Mountains and the cities of Vancouver, Victoria, and Calgary. Some of the most popular destinations in Central Canada are Niagara Falls, Toronto,...
1 2 3 4 115
Page 2 of 115